btc$9188.7
eth$238.36
xrp$0.197
Курсы криптовалют

Джон Кантрелл рассказал как ему удалось взломать кошелек Алистера Милна

Джон Кантрелл, создатель и разработчик сервиса Juggernaut, который работает на Lightning Network, расшифровал мнемоническую фразу от кошелька с одним биткоином с помощью подбора вариантов. Это было не кражей, а конкурсом, из которого он вышел победителем. Также Кантрелл написал в своем блоге как он это сделал.

Предприниматель Алистер Милн объявил в своем Twitterаккаунте о конкурсе с призом в 1 BTC. Участникам нужно было разгадать ключ из двенадцати слов, а Милн периодически оставлял искателям подсказки на своей странице.

Во избежание брутфорса он хотел выложить в сеть последние пару слов, однако не успел. Зная восемь слов, Кантрелл смог подобрать ключ и забрать биткоин.

Разработчик начал готовиться к взлому перед публикацией восьмой подсказки. У себя на странице он сообщил читателям, что 8 слов дают около 1,1 трлн предполагаемых комбинаций, каждую из которых нужно проверить.

Когда он уже написал специальную программу оказалось, что его оборудование не подходит для подобных задач. Вычислительная мощность компьютера позволяла проверять лишь 1250 вариантов в секунду, исходя из чего ему понадобилось бы 25 лет прежде чем он проверит все комбинации.

Тогда Кантрелл арендовал несколько десятков графических процессоров у Microsoft Azure, чтобы увеличить скорость обработки. С публикацией восьмого слова он запустил проверку. По его подсчетам на подбор мнемоника понадобилось бы около 25 часов.

Кантрелл надеялся, что найдет разгадку на 50% выполненной работы. Однако на 85% ответа все еще не было. Разработчик начал сомневаться в верности настройки систем, но немногим позже, на 91% он нашел разгадку.

После открытия кошелька он сразу же перевел средства на свой адрес, чтобы обезопасить себя от остальных искателей, которые также были близки к разгадке.

Подписывайтесь на наши социальные сети:

Оцените качество статьи:

(0 голосов, в среднем: 5 из 5)
  1. 5
  2. 4
  3. 3
  4. 2
  5. 1
Комментарии | 0
Комментариев (0)